U.F.O. The Movie is quite the curious piece from 1993, directed by Tony Dow. It has this weird blend of comedy and sci-fi that you don’t see much anymore. Roy 'Chubby' Brown really takes center stage here, and his performance is, well, definitely something you can't ignore. The premise—being abducted by feminist aliens—is as outrageous as it sounds. The pacing can feel a bit off at times, but it kind of adds to that awkward charm. Plus, the practical effects, while not groundbreaking, have a certain low-budget flair that makes it all the more amusing. It leans heavily into social commentary, making for a bizarre yet interesting watch, especially if you're into films that toe the line between absurdity and critique.
